Definitions
(noun) weapons considered collectively. Synonyms: weaponry, implements of war, weapons system, munition.

(noun) the official symbols of a family, state, etc.. Synonyms: coat of arms, blazon, blazonry.

(noun) a human limb; technically the part of the superior limb between the shoulder and the elbow but commonly used to refer to the whole superior limb. Synonyms: arm.

(noun) any projection that is thought to resemble a human arm. Synonyms: arm, branch, limb. Examples: "The arm of the record player." "An arm of the sea." "A branch of the sewer."

(noun) any instrument or instrumentality used in fighting or hunting. Synonyms: weapon, arm, weapon system. Example: "He was licensed to carry a weapon."

(noun) the part of an armchair or sofa that supports the elbow and forearm of a seated person. Synonyms: arm.

(noun) a division of some larger or more complex organization. Synonyms: branch, subdivision, arm. Examples: "A branch of congress." "Botany is a branch of biology." "The germanic branch of indo-european languages."

(noun) the part of a garment that is attached at the armhole and that provides a cloth covering for the arm. Synonyms: sleeve, arm.

(verb) prepare oneself for a military confrontation. Synonyms: arm, build up, fortify, gird. Examples: "The u.s. is girding for a conflict in the middle east." "Troops are building up on the iraqi border."
